I would love to end up with Orlando Brown as well. The fact that he could clear some bad karma for his family by coming back to the Browns, as well as the familiarity of bringing the Blindside blocker for our franchise quarterback from college, makes it a perfect fit. That said, if I were a betting man, I would bet that he will with almost all certainty be there at pick 64 for us, if not later. I wouldn't want to use in any higher of a pick on him because he literally had the worst combine of all time. Really let that sink in, Dizzy. And yeah, I'm saying we use that to our advantage and get a great player at a value pick.

Thank you to everyone for taking the time to comment and provide feedback.....

I am still working on a few things......for instance there is a huge debate in my head to take the CB Alexander from Louisville at the top of 2, and then draft the kid (left tackle) from NC A&T or the kid from West Georgia at the top of the 4.

I see Chub as the best defender in the draft......I could be wrong......but I have been dreaming of pumping up our passrush and "Overloading" a strength. It worked for the Giants......

I also see Coutland Sutton as the best WR in this entire draft class. I am not impressed by the kid from Alabama (I think he'll be good), my top 5 WR's in this draft are (1. Sutton (SMU) 2. Anthony Miller (Memphis) 3. Kristian Kirk (Tex AM) 4. Ridley (Ala) 5. St. Brown (ND) with Honorable mentions going to 6. Ritchie James MTSU and 6.b Michale Gallup Col St.......Trey Quinn from SMU I think is Wes Welker reincarnated)

Huge Fan of Shak Griff.....I think the hand thing is going to put him in the 3rd day of the draft......He reminds me of one of my boys I went to College with named Ron G., one of the coolest cats from NY you ever want to meet. We went to school together for 4 years and I NEVER noticed he only had one hand until our Sr. year in school......SERIOUSLY......so I think we benefit here.

PJ Hall I found late in the process, just a couple of weeks ago.....I saw a stat where a 6'1 DT blocked 14 kicks in his college career......made me think to find this kid.....then I saw some of his film....and then I saw the numbers from his pro day......if this kid is there in 6th, I will be AMAZED. This kid is a raw version of an Arron Donald clone......

Jacobs I didnt research until I saw his Combine numbers....after seeing some of his Wisc. tape, I think there are a lot of tools for Greg Williams to work with there. And the kid is mad versatile, playing DE, OLB, ILB and FB......this is the kind of kid the Patriots take with one of their 4th/5th round compensatory selections.

IMO, and this is after watching RB's HARD for the past 2 seasons....Penny is my #2 RB right behind Barkley.....

I am still working on setting my final draft board.
